I think the ending of this novel is very unique. The ending
of the book is happy but not a happily ever after ending. I think the author did
this to show that happiness often comes from friendship and when people feel needed
and important. He accomplished this through the four main characters.
I think the author, Nick Hornby, is teaching the reader that to be happy
a mansion, a prince, or millions of dollars are not needed. To be happy, all we really need are the
necessities of life (shelter, food and water), friendship, and the feeling of being
needed. Another theme of the story is to
be happy with what we have because there are many people who seem like
everything is fine, but they are in much worse situations.
